To determine which graph contains the point (−5, 8), we need to identify the coordinates:

- The x-coordinate is -5.
- The y-coordinate is 8.

We can break down the quadrants on a standard Cartesian plane:

- Quadrant I: x > 0, y > 0
- Quadrant II: x < 0, y > 0
- Quadrant III: x < 0, y < 0
- Quadrant IV: x > 0, y < 0

Since the x-coordinate is -5 (which is less than 0) and the y-coordinate is 8 (which is greater than 0), the point (−5, 8) is located in Quadrant II.
